This position has been designated as On-Site working 5-days per week out of our Trane La Crosse R&D Lab .
Job Summary :
Trane Technologies has an exciting opportunity for an on-site position in our Engineering Test Laboratory (Lab) as an HVAC Product Development Technician II . Your primary function in this position is testing of New Product Development (NPD), sustainability, and quality improvement projects, in addition to some agency compliance. Your technician role will support qualifying Trane Applied Compression and Commercial Heating, Ventilation and Air Conditioning (HVAC) products. The position requires problem solving, troubleshooting, and collaboration with other lab and engineering team members to ensure timely completion of projects.
